Exploring Rental Options for Low Credit in Long Beach

Long Beach offers a variety of rental options for those with a credit score of 600 or below. With 32 active listings currently available, renters can explore different neighborhoods such as Belmont Heights and Retro Row, where you might find a mix of vintage charm and modern amenities. The median rent stands at $1,950, giving you a good sense of what to expect in terms of budget.

In neighborhoods like Downtown Long Beach, you’ll find apartments that cater to young professionals and students alike. Many buildings here offer easy access to public transit, dining, and entertainment. If you're considering a two-bedroom apartment, this area could be a great fit, especially if you're sharing costs with a roommate.

Bixby Knolls is another neighborhood worth considering; it tends to have a more suburban feel with tree-lined streets and family-friendly parks. This area might offer more spacious apartments, perfect for those looking for a quieter community while still being close to the vibrant Long Beach atmosphere.

How does the application process work for these listings?
When applying for an apartment with a 600 credit score, landlords may consider other factors such as income and rental history. Be prepared to provide documentation that demonstrates your financial stability, which can help strengthen your application.
Are there additional fees associated with renting with a low credit score?
Some landlords might require a higher security deposit or charge a slightly higher rent. It's essential to ask about any potential fees upfront to avoid surprises later in the process.
Can I use a co-signer if my credit score is 600?
Yes, many landlords in Long Beach are open to co-signers, which can help improve your chances of securing a rental. A co-signer with a higher credit score can provide additional assurance to landlords.
